Hi As of this morning, each time when trying to enter my gallery all I see is a message "Gallery 2.3 upgraded" (see attached picture). Even though my gallery is already 2.3 it is impossible to bypass this page and go do any album in my gallery. I am not sure if it is malware or a legitimate upgrade issue that require password etc. Can you try to enter my gallery at www.ruvyamir.co.il/gallery2 or look at the attached pic and let me know if I should go along and process the upgraded. If the upgraded is not a gallery legit item could anyone advice me how to get rid of it and be able to enter my gallery and see images again. Your prompt reply will be most appreciated Ruvy

There is a file called versions.dat in the root of your g2data directory. If gallery can no longer read from this file then it prompts to upgrade. Also, running the upgrader would do no harm. -s |
